在计算机图形学、游戏开发和地理信息系统中,Python四叉树实现是一种非常重要的空间数据结构。它能够高效地组织二维空间中的点或对象,提升...
在C#编程中,数组是存储多个相同类型数据的基本结构。但你是否知道,C#不仅支持我们常见的“一维数组”,还提供了多维数组和交错数组两种高级...
在C++编程中,宏定义(Macro Definition)是一个非常基础但又极其重要的概念。它由预处理器处理,在编译之前就对源代码进行文...
在计算机科学中,C语言最短路径算法是图论中的一个经典问题。无论是在地图导航、网络路由还是社交关系分析中,寻找两点之间的最短路径都至关重要...
在Python编程中,Python format函数 是处理字符串格式化最常用、最灵活的工具之一。无论你是刚入门的小白,还是有一定经验的...
在当今网络安全日益重要的时代,开发安全、高效、可靠的通信协议变得至关重要。而 Rust语言 凭借其卓越的 内存安全 特性,正成为构建安全...
在 Java 编程中,处理大文件或高并发 I/O 操作时,传统的 FileInputStream 和 FileOutputStream...
在学习 Python __init__.py 文件时,很多初学者会感到困惑:这个看似空空如也的文件到底有什么用?为什么有些项目里有它,有...
在Java开发中,Java系统属性(System Properties)是一个非常实用但常被初学者忽视的功能。它们可以帮助我们获取当前J...
在Rust编程教程中,方法链(Method Chaining)是一个非常实用且优雅的编程技巧。它允许我们将多个方法调用“串”在一起,使代...
在 Go语言 开发中,经常需要将数字转换为字符串,或将字符串解析为数字。这时,strconv 包就派上大用场了!本教程将带你从零开始,深...
在软件开发中,C语言基准测试是评估程序运行效率的重要手段。无论你是刚接触C语言的新手,还是希望优化现有代码的开发者,掌握如何进行性能测试...
在计算机视觉和图像处理领域,边缘检测是一项基础而重要的技术。它能帮助我们识别图像中物体的轮廓、边界等关键信息。本教程将手把手教你如何使用...
在自然语言处理、拼写检查、DNA序列比对等领域,Java编辑距离算法是一种非常基础且重要的技术。本文将手把手教你理解并实现Levensh...
在 Python面向对象编程 中,Python对象实例化 是一个核心概念。无论你是刚接触编程的新手,还是有一定经验的开发者,理解如何创建...